"sigh" Paisley's music video of the year, in case you like to see it, is "Waitin on a Woman", that had Paisley sitting on a bench in a mall, and his date never shows up, but an older man sits down and tells him about waiting on a woman who is always late, and that he will probably be the first to go, and he'll find a bench there in Heaven, if they have any, and wait for her. It's funny, and sad, and beautiful all the while. The older guy part was done so beautifully, by Andy Griffith. Who, at the end of the filming of the video, presented a gift to Brad - the guitar he played on the Mayberry shows.
